sessionStorage在浏览器会话期间有效,而localStorage是持久的。 sessionStorage在用户关闭浏览器标签页或窗口时会被清除,而localStorage会一直保留。 sessionStorage和localStorage的使用方法相似,都是使用setItem、getItem和removeItem方法进行操作。 2、sessionStorage、localStorage、cookie区别 存储容量:sessionStorage和localStorage都提...
log(JSON.parse(result)) // console.log(sessionStorage.getItem('msg3')) } // 删除一个数据 function deleteData(){ sessionStorage.removeItem('msg2') } // 清空一个数据 function deleteAllData(){ sessionStorage.clear() } 两者区别 localStorage 浏览器关闭之后,数据打开还在 sessionStorage浏览器关闭...
localStorage有效期是永久的。一般的浏览器能存储的是5MB左右。sessionStorage api与localStorage相同。 sessionStorage默认的有效期是浏览器的会话时间(也就是说标签页关闭后就消失了)。 localStorage作用域是协议、主机名、端口。(理论上,不人为的删除,一直存在设备中) sessionStorage作用域是窗口、协议、主机名、端口。 知...
sessionStorage和localStorage都只能存储字符串类型,对于复杂的对象可以使用ECMAScript提供的JSON.stringify(obj)将其转成字符串,取出来时使用 JSON.parse(str)重新转成对象。由于在开发过程中容易忘记将复杂的对象转换成字符串来进行存储,而对sessionStorage/localStorage的二次封装很好的解决了这个问题。 sessionStorage或localS...
webStorage【浏览器本地存储】 localStorage和sessionStorage统称为webStorage 1. localStorage 未登录账号的情况下进行了商品搜索,搜索历史中保存了之前的搜索记录 借助浏览器的本地存储可以将数据存到硬盘上,用于缓存数据 通过浏览器如何查看浏览器
【localStorage】 【sessionStorage】 2、存储键值对的时候,必须是字符串,如果要存储对象,需要使用JSON进行转化 3、用户删除Storage只有两个办法。一是remove方法或者是clear方法。二是在Application里面手动删除 本次分享就到这里了。希望大家多多支持。也希望大家每天进步。不疾而速,不行而至!附代码 ...
sessionStorage 临时存储在客户端中,关闭浏览器后就会清空。 localStorage 永久存储在客户端中,只有在清空缓存或手工删除或代码删除后才会清空。 localStorage的使用 语法 // 将值写入到用户浏览器中// 普通字符串可以直接写入localStorage.setItem('存储在浏览器中的键', 存储在浏览器中的值)// 如果是对象或者是数组...
详解Vue中localstorage和sessionstorage的使用 1. 项目使用中暴露出来的几个问题 大家到处直接使用localstorage['aaa']='这是一段示例字符串'这些原生语法实现,这样耦合度太高了,假如有一天我们需要换实现方式,或者对存储大小做一些控制,那么需要修改的代码就会很多 ...
Vue中使用LocalStorage和SessionStorage LocalStorage和SessionStorage 在使用之前,我们先废话的了解一下LocalStorage和SessionStorage 1.sessionStorage(临时存储):为没一个数据维持一个存储区域,浏览器打开会创建,关闭浏览器就会消失。 2.localStorage(长期存储):和前者一样,区别在于浏览器关闭后数据依然存在。
1.不同浏览器之间无法共享LocalStorage或SessionStorage中的数据。 2.LocalStorage和SessionStorage可以使用统一的API接口。 3.LocalStorage或SessionStorage通常以键/值对形式的字符串进行存储,所以在存储时需要对数据格式进行转换,使用JSON.stringify方法将对象转换成字符串,提取时用JSON.parse方法将字符串转换成对象。